Sami El-Molla Vidal

Product Specialist

Sami brings to InsectBiotech experience in the agri-food sector, particularly focused on sustainable development of innovative products and comprehensive value chain analysis. Specialized in transforming agricultural by-products into organic fertilizers and biostimulants using black soldier fly larvae (BSF), Sami collaborates with institutions such as the University of Granada (UGR) to optimize processes and comply with European regulations.

Education

Sami holds a Master’s degree in Agri-food Sciences “Food Identity,” completed at universities in France (École Supérieure d’Agricultures d’Angers, VetAgro Sup), Italy (Università Cattolica del Sacro Cuore), Romania (University of Agricultural Sciences and Veterinary Medicine), and Greece (Centre for Research and Technology Hellas – CERTH). Through this program, Sami gained an international perspective on food safety (HACCP), applied microbiology, value chain analysis, and the development of sustainable local products.

Professional Experience

In 2024, as an Intern Researcher at Origin for Sustainability (Switzerland), Sami participated in a study focused on the sustainable development of traditional dairy products in mountainous regions, analyzing the impact of Protected Designations of Origin (PDO) in Italy’s Molise region. This work resulted in a scientific publication as lead author in the journal MDPI.

Previously, Sami collaborated with the AgroTransilvania Cluster (Romania, 2023) as a consultant on a project to reactivate farmers’ markets. Sami also contributed remotely to launching an NGO focused on social aid and reducing food waste, managing a student team. Additionally, Sami worked with Centro ASSAGGIATORI – Italian Tasters (Italy, 2023), helping create professional sensory analysis tests and participating in specialized courses on emblematic products such as coffee, cocoa, tomato, olive oil, Parmigiano cheese, Modena balsamic vinegar, wine, and honey.

 

Fluent in Spanish, English, French, and Italian, Sami effectively facilitates communication within international teams, enhancing multicultural collaboration.
